| Protein names | Recommended name: Potassium channel toxin alpha-KTx 10.2 Alternative name(s): Cobatoxin-2 Short name=CoTx2 |
| Organism | Centruroides noxius (Mexican scorpion) |
| Taxonomic identifier | 6878 [NCBI] |
| Taxonomic lineage | Eukaryota › Metazoa › Arthropoda › Chelicerata › Arachnida › Scorpiones › Buthida › Buthoidea › Buthidae › Centruroides |
Protein attributes
| Sequence length | 32 AA. |
| Sequence status | Complete. |
| Protein existence | Evidence at protein level |
General annotation (Comments)
| Function | Blocks Shaker B potassium-channels (Kv1.1/KCNA1 sub-family). Ref.1 |
| Subcellular location | |
| Tissue specificity | Expressed by the venom gland. |
| Sequence similarities | Belongs to the short scorpion toxin superfamily. Potassium channel inhibitor family. Alpha-KTx 10 subfamily. |
